I'm about to attach the Yamaha tuning fork stock tank emblems to my VMax (the replacement factory carbon fibre tank used in the rebuild came without emblems), and wanted to know if others had done it and knew of the best way to do so.

I've read something like this is the way to go: http://www.autogeek.net/3m-auto-tape.html

Is that the correct product to use? Original emblems have been difficult to get, and the last thing I want is to lose them on a road trip because the attachment method fails.
 
I re-attached the original tank badges to my re-shaped tank using ordinary two-sided foam tape. That was seven years ago. They have never budged.
Looks like the 3M tape in your link is similar, only a better grade. I'm sure it would work fine.
If you use a tape that is not black foam, just go around the perimeter with a black marker pen, before mounting to your tank. makes for a more in extrusive installation.

Nevermind, I found it. However, I'm confused. Why would there be two different part numbers for left and right? Would they not be EXACTLY the same? My parts search came up with 1FK-21781-00-00 and
1FK-21782-00-00 ??? WTH??? :ummm:
 
^ I'd guess that one is a Left side emblem and one is a right side emblem.
They are probably curved and oriented slightly differently so they match when installed.
I've never actually seen them off the bike to compare them though.
 
They are slightly different due to the curvature of the cover. It should be apparent when you get them and pre-fit.
